Rochester New York Football Club to Play at MCC in 2022

Great news, Tribunes!

Yesterday, at a media conference hosted by Monroe County Executive Adam Bello, MLS NEXT Pro announced the 21 clubs that will compete in the new professional league’s inaugural 2022 season, including the Rochester New York Football Club (RNY FC) who will play at MCC!

According to the media release, “Rochester NY FC will serve as MLS NEXT Pro’s inaugural independent club. Rochester NY FC, founded in 1996 as the Rochester Rhinos and rebranded this September, is owned by David and Wendy Dworkin, and co-owned by Premier League striker, and former England National Team star, Jamie Vardy of Leicester City F.C.”

RNY FC will play MLS teams from major cities like Chicago, Miami, Toronto and Vancouver during the 2022 season.

The partnership also opens doors for MCC students and others to pursue internships and gain experience and have access to a professional sports experience.

RNY FC practices will be held at a separate location in Henrietta. MCC is providing space for games in such a way that will complement and not interfere with MCC Tribunes soccer and lacrosse matches.

MLS NEXT Pro’s inaugural season will begin in March and culminate in postseason action in September. We anticipate RNY FC’s first home game at John L. DiMarco Field on the Brighton Campus will be in April 2022. The full 2022 match schedule and more details will be announced at a later date.
